For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 418 students in Clinton, AR.
The top-ranked public high school in Clinton, AR is Clinton High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Clinton, AR public high school have an average math proficiency score of 32% (versus the Arkansas public high school average of 27%), and reading proficiency score of 51% (versus the 40% statewide average). High schools in Clinton have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Arkansas public high schools.
Clinton, AR public high school have a Graduation Rate of 92%, which is more than the Arkansas average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Clinton High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Arkansas or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Arkansas public high school average of 41% (majority Black).
